    When I was growing up, this was the "rich people" mall servicing Windermere, not too far away. Unfortunately between Millennia opening, the 2008 economic collapse, and Winter Garden village opening, the wealthier Windermere residents went to there, leaving West Oaks mall attracting businesses and residents from the neighboring very dangerous Pine Hills neighborhood.
